    Exhibits Specialist, Don Darcy of the Hampton Roads Naval Museum works on the empty gallery of the museum’s latest exhibit about the U.S. Navy in the Vietnam War. The exhibit opened to the public in October 2019 and encompasses just over 5,000 square feet of gallery space at their museum, located on the second deck of the Nauticus campus in Downtown Norfolk, Virginia. The exhibit encompasses areas of Intelligence, Riverine Operations, Naval Gunfire Support, Logistics, Non-Combat Support Operations, Prisoners of War, and Aerial Operations among other roles that the US Navy performed during the conflict. The exhibit also incorporates oral histories with area Vietnam War Veterans in an immersive exhibit. (US Navy photo by Clay Farrington/Released).
